#d6e289 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#d6e289 is composed of 83.9% red, 88.6%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.4%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 68.1 degrees, a saturation of 60.5% and a lightness of 71.2%. #d6e289 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#adc513.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

● #d6e289 color description : Very soft yellow.
The hexadecimal color #d6e289 has RGB values of R:214, G:226, B:137 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0, Y:0.39,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14082697.
